Geography of Outdoor Recreation

Atmospheric & Earth SciencesUndergraduateCollege of Science and Engineering

Outcome

Assess the value of geographic resources (physical and cultural) as a catalyst for tourism, and summarize the importance of conservation in protecting these resources.

Outcome

Describe the creation and historical evolution of land management agencies in the United States as it relates to outdoor recreation/tourism.

Outcome

Specify dominant attractions and resources located within individual national parks, forests, refuges and other public lands.

Outcome

Analyze outdoor recreation locations.
